Log Message:
security/ruby-sshkit: update to 1.20.0
Update ruby-sshkit package to 1.20.0.
## [1.20.0][] (2019-08-03)
* [#468](https://github.com/capistrano/sshkit/pull/468): Make `upload!` take a \
`:verbosity` option like `exec` does - [@grosser](https://github.com/grosser)
## [1.19.1][] (2019-07-02)
* [#465](https://github.com/capistrano/sshkit/pull/456): Fix a regression in \
1.19.0 that prevented `~` from being used in Capistrano paths, e.g. \
`:deploy_to`, etc. - [@grosser](https://github.com/grosser)
## [1.19.0][] (2019-06-30)
* [#455](https://github.com/capistrano/sshkit/pull/455): Ensure UUID of \
commands are stable in logging - [@lazyatom](https://github.com/lazyatom)
* [#453](https://github.com/capistrano/sshkit/pull/453): `as` and `within` now \
properly escape their user/group/path arguments, and the command nested within \
an `as` block is now properly escaped before passing to `sh -c`. In the unlikely \
case that you were manually escaping commands passed to SSHKit as a workaround, \
you will no longer need to do this. See \
[#458](https://github.com/capistrano/sshkit/issues/458) for examples of what has \
been fixed. - [@grosser](https://github.com/grosser)
* [#460](https://github.com/capistrano/sshkit/pull/460): Handle IPv6 addresses \
without port - [@will-in-wi](https://github.com/will-in-wi)
## [1.18.2][] (2019-02-03)
* [#448](https://github.com/capistrano/sshkit/pull/448): Fix misbehaving \
connection eviction loop when disabling connection pooling - [Sebastian \
Cohnen](https://github.com/tisba)
## [1.18.1][] (2019-01-26)
* [#447](https://github.com/capistrano/sshkit/pull/447): Fix broken thread \
safety by widening critical section - [Takumasa \
Ochi](https://github.com/aeroastro)
